To: [EMAIL PROTECTED] ups.comFrom: literacydog12406@ yahoo.comDate: Tue, 9 Sep 2008 04:24:53 -0700Subject: RE: [Chihuahuas] UTI's Hi ! It wasn't that easy! haha! He is so small and he pees like a girl, so I took a plastic cup and cut it down to about an inch deep. It was easier to stick under his legs! Let your little one smell it before you try to use it though, otherwise they will stop in midstream to "check it out"!! Also, you really don't need a whole lot for the test! Good luck! EP.S.
